diff src/http/modules/ngx_http_limit_zone_module.c @ 1029:ce08bc4cb97b

ngx_strn2cmp() > ngx_memn2cmp()
author Igor Sysoev <igor@sysoev.ru>
date Fri, 12 Jan 2007 21:58:02 +0000
parents 38be15c1379a
children defdce84b172
line wrap: on
line diff
--- a/src/http/modules/ngx_http_limit_zone_module.c
+++ b/src/http/modules/ngx_http_limit_zone_module.c
@@ -179,7 +179,7 @@ ngx_http_limit_zone_handler(ngx_http_req
         do {
             lz = (ngx_http_limit_zone_node_t *) &node->color;
 
-            rc = ngx_strn2cmp(lz->data, vv->data, (size_t) lz->len, len);
+            rc = ngx_memn2cmp(lz->data, vv->data, (size_t) lz->len, len);
 
             if (rc == 0) {
                 if ((ngx_uint_t) lz->conn < lzcf->conn) {
@@ -266,7 +266,7 @@ ngx_http_limit_zone_rbtree_insert_value(
             lzn = (ngx_http_limit_zone_node_t *) &node->color;
             lznt = (ngx_http_limit_zone_node_t *) &temp->color;
 
-            if (ngx_strn2cmp(lzn->data, lznt->data, lzn->len, lznt->len) < 0) {
+            if (ngx_memn2cmp(lzn->data, lznt->data, lzn->len, lznt->len) < 0) {
 
                 if (temp->left == sentinel) {
                     temp->left = node;